New Challenges in the Process of Future Military Pilots Selection
Original language description
The article describes the current admission process of selecting students for the military pilot specialization, points out its shortcomings and suggests an adjustment to the selection procedure that would lead to a more suitable selection of students both from an economic point of view and from the point of view of the needs of the Army of the Czech Republic and further work of pilots in the army. These adjustments to the selection process are proposed not only on the basis of precisely defined characteristics and skills that an applicant for studies in the military pilot specialization must have, but also against the background of the current geopolitical situation. With a high-quality selection process, we are able to secure the selection of the most suitable candidates, with a very high percentage of probability that they will help us in the event of an escalation of tense relations between the European Union and the Russian Federation. Based on the effective selection process of suitable candidates for individual positions in the army, it is more likely that in the event of further escalation of tense relations between the European Union and the Russian Federation, we will be able to successfully overcome this escalation.
